When you are hiring a lawyer, make sure that there is a discussion about the payment plan that you want to instill. Sometimes, you may not have all of the money upfront, so you will want to workout a monthly plan that suits you comfortably. Get this done ahead of time so you don't have to worry about it later.
A good tip if you're looking to bring on a lawyer is to make sure you thoroughly investigate whether or not a certain lawyer will be a good fit. It's generally a good idea to go over a few different lawyers at a time and compare them to each other.
Try to match the firm that you choose with the seriousness of the situation that you are in. If you are in a serious bind, you will want to have a big firm by your side. If you are trying to beat a moving violation, you can get a lawyer that belongs to a smaller firm.

Listen to your lawyer's advice and remember they work for you. If you're not comfortable with certain things, tell them so. This way, your lawyer will know exactly what you desire.
Do not pick a lawyer because you saw their ad on television or on a billboard. Many big firms that can afford this type of advertising use lawyers that are fresh out of school for most of their cases, but charge you for the experience held by its highest lawyers.

When working in cooperation with a lawyer, you must communicate clearly and completely. If your case has deadlines attached to it, then you must provide your lawyer with anything that is needed. This will only help the outcome of your case.
When picking out a lawyer, be sure you learn whatever you can about their reputation. By consulting the bar association in your state as well as online lawyer review resources, it will be possible for you to determine whether or not you wish to pursue a professional relationship with a given practitioner. That can save you money, time and aggravation, later.

Do not let your lawyer impress you by using complicated legal terms. If your lawyer uses terms you do not understand, stop them and ask for an explanation. You should know that some lawyers will use this technique to make you feel powerless and present themselves as the ideal solution to your problems.
If you are taking someone to court on principle rather than money, you will have a hard time finding a lawyer. You'll be troublesome and one that's not satisfied with the outcome. If you desire to pursue litigation against another person, first look at whether it is financially prudent to do so. The principle behind lawsuits should be secondary to the cost it would take to sue another person.
If you are getting a divorce, and the details do not involve child custody or complicated details, consider settling out of court. If the divorce is simple and nothing is being contested, an out of court agreement can be drawn up by an attorney. The agreement only needs to be finalized by a judge with no legal representation by either party required.
Always double-check with the bar association in your state to make sure anyone you are considering hiring is actually licensed. In rare instances, someone may have been disbarred or suspended and is still trying to work. Obviously, getting involved in this type of situation will do nothing for your case, so it is best to avoid problems at any cost.
